Why
Green structural checks did not certify the factual accuracy of GeoNames
coordinates or establish rights over the historical pre-clean-room material.
The current pipeline now distinguishes those concerns and no longer
redistributes the unresolved material.
The public Git history was rewritten before this PR so the withdrawn paths and
pre-clean-room data blobs are no longer reachable from public branches.
